Kenneth P. Fox
Vice President, On-site Power Solutions


Ken Fox is vice president, on-site power solutions at UTC Power. He is responsible for all aspects of the company’s stationary power businesses.

Fox joined UTC Power in 2007 after 17 years with Carrier Corporation, a United Technologies Corporation (UTC) sister division. At Carrier, Fox led the profitable growth of the residential and commercial controls business from a small break-even entity to one of Carrier’s highest growth and most profitable businesses. Fox led the acquisition of Automated Logic Corporation in 2004, further growing Carrier’s presence is the building automation sector. In his most recent assignment at Carrier, he was responsible for the North American commercial business, which included sales, service, national accounts, Automated Logic and Carrier Electronics.

Prior to joining UTC, Fox was vice president at Bank of America’s Investment Banking Group, specializing in alternative energy project funding. Previously he served as group manager at Exxon Corporation where he was responsible for project management of petro-chemical facilities.

Fox earned a bachelor of science degree in civil engineering from Northeastern University and a master of science degree in management from the Sloan School of Management at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(M.I.T.).

United Technologies Corp., based in Hartford, Conn., provides high-technology products and services to the building and aerospace industries. Its UTC Power unit, based in South Windsor, Conn., is a full-service provider of environmentally advanced power solutions. With nearly 50 years of experience, UTC Power is a world leader in developing and producing fuel cells for on-site power, transportation, space and defense applications, and a developer of innovative combined cooling, heating and power applications for the distributed energy market.
